摘要
The choice of technique of persistence of data is a factor important for the success of a system computational, being directly connected the questions like integrity, confiability, facility of maintenance and, especially, the performance. The present article performs a study comparative between the use of relational database (BDR), relational database with use of frameworks for mapping object/relational and object-oriented database (BDOO), having like main goal compare the performance of SGBDs in the context of applications web. For this investigation were used: MySQL like BDR, Hibernate like framework, DB4o like BDOO, Glassfish like server web and Java like platform.
